NHLers GoPro with Action Cams on Players – Sample Video

The NHL will have players wear GoPro action cams starting at the All-Star game to get footage for live hockey broadcasts. You’ll never have seen the game this way if you’ve never played, and not at this speed unless you’re a professional level player.
